The power metering market in Morocco is expanding due to the government`s efforts to modernize the electricity distribution network and improve energy efficiency. Power meters are crucial for measuring electricity consumption accurately and enabling demand-side management. The market is driven by the increasing deployment of smart meters, which provide real-time data and support efficient energy management practices. Additionally, incentives for energy conservation and rising electricity tariffs are boosting market growth.
The Morocco power metering market is driven by regulatory mandates for accurate billing and monitoring of electricity consumption. Advanced metering infrastructure (AMI) systems enable real-time data collection and remote meter reading, improving billing accuracy and operational efficiency for utilities. As the government promotes energy conservation and renewable energy integration, the adoption of smart metering solutions is expected to increase, driving market expansion.
Challenges in the power metering market include concerns regarding data privacy and security, accuracy and reliability of metering equipment, and regulatory barriers hindering the adoption of advanced metering infrastructure (AMI) technologies.
The government of Morocco has implemented policies to regulate the power metering market, including standards for accuracy and reliability, licensing requirements for manufacturers and installers, and initiatives to promote smart metering technologies. These policies aim to improve billing accuracy, monitor energy consumption, and support demand-side management programs.
